Rabuka reminds civil servants of the important roles they play in the country

Prime Minister Sitiveni Rabuka reminded the civil servants of the important roles they play in drafting policies to ensure the swift delivery of service and programs for people in the Country.

While officiating at the Civil Servants Week celebration at Albert Park this morning, Rabuka echoed sentiments of gratitude, service, sacrifice, and commitment that the civil servants continue to do.

He says their dedication shows a great sense of national service and pride in the country.

There were also medals handed out to some civil servants with Rabuka stressing the meaning of the medals given.

He says the medals are recognitions of their hard work and it symbolizes the sweat, blood, tears, and their sacrifices.

Hundreds of Civil Servants gathered in numbers and marched through Suva City to Albert Park this morning.

Today will be the last day of the week-long celebration for the civil servants around the country.
